Custom window replacement services involve removing existing windows and installing new, high-quality units tailored to the specific needs of a property. This process typically includes selecting the right style, material, and size of windows to match the home's design and improve overall functionality. Skilled contractors handle the entire installation, ensuring the new windows fit properly, operate smoothly, and enhance the appearance of the property. Homeowners often choose custom replacements to upgrade their windows for better aesthetics or to incorporate modern features that improve energy efficiency and security.

These services help address several common problems that homeowners encounter with their existing windows. For example, older windows may have become drafty, allowing outdoor air to enter and increasing heating or cooling costs. Windows that no longer open or close properly can pose safety concerns or restrict ventilation. Additionally, damaged or broken glass, cracked frames, or rotting wood can compromise the integrity of the window and lead to further structural issues. Custom window replacement offers a solution to these issues, restoring comfort, safety, and energy efficiency to the home.

Properties that typically benefit from custom window replacement include older homes with outdated windows, new constructions seeking a tailored fit, and properties experiencing specific issues like leaks, drafts, or damage. Residential buildings, including single-family homes, multi-family units, and historic properties, often require custom solutions to meet their unique architectural and functional needs. Commercial properties, such as retail stores or office buildings, may also use custom window replacements to improve curb appeal, security, or energy performance. The overview below groups typical Custom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Portland, OR.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window replacements or repairs in Portland range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this band, especially for single-pane or small window fixes. Larger or more complex repairs can sometimes exceed this range but are less common.

Standard Replacement - Replacing standard-sized windows with basic features gener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Most projects in this category land in the middle of this range, depending on materials and installation specifics. Fewer projects reach into the higher tiers for premium options.

Custom or Energy-Efficient Windows - Installing custom-sized or energy-efficient windows typically costs from $2,500 to $6,000 per window. Many local contractors handle these projects within this range, though larger, more elaborate installations can go beyond $6,000.

Full Home Window Replacement - Replacing all windows in a home can range from $10,000 to over $30,000, depending on the number of windows and their style. Most projects fall into the mid-range, with larger homes or high-end materials pushing costs higher.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of windows can be replaced with custom services? Local contractors can handle a variety of window types, including double-hung, casement, picture, and specialty custom-designed windows tailored to specific home styles and needs.

Are custom window replacements suitable for historic or unique home styles? Yes, many service providers specialize in custom solutions that preserve the character of historic or architecturally distinctive homes while updating their windows.

How do local contractors ensure the fit and finish of custom windows? They typically take precise measurements and work with manufacturers to create windows that match your specifications, ensuring proper fit and aesthetic consistency.

Can custom window replacement improve energy efficiency? Many local pros offer options that enhance insulation and sealing, which can contribute to better energy performance in your home.

What materials are available for custom window replacements? Service providers often work with materials such as wood, vinyl, aluminum, or composite, allowing for a range of styles and durability options based on preferences and needs.
